Matthew Soerens
Matthew Soerens is the U.S. Director of Church Mobilization for World Relief, a humanitarian organization dedicated to assisting refugees and vulnerable populations. In light of the recent immigration policy changes implemented by the Trump administration, he has provided insight into how these measures may impact refugees and those with temporary humanitarian protections, emphasizing the need for a nuanced understanding of the guidelines that could affect their eligibility for green cards.
